Australia - Export of Dairy Machinery
Since 2014, Australia Export of Dairy Machinery fell by 0.2% year on year. With $2,721,644.1 in 2019, the country was ranked number 27 among other countries in Export of Dairy Machinery. Australia is overtaken by Czech Republic, which was number 26 at $2,752,116 and is followed by Belgium with $2,719,991.47. Denmark lead the ranking with $84,013,248 in 2019, a decrease of 3.6% versus 2018. Italy, Germany and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bosnia and Herzegovina witnessed the best average annual growth at +179.4% per year, while Botswana recorded the worst performance at -67.1% per year.
